The Wildlife, Parks & Day Life Department,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(Wildlife Division Dera Ismail Khan) has announced new vacancies for the position of Wildlife Watcher (BPS-07). These positions are permanent and based on the recruitment policy of the KPK government.

Wildlife Department DI Khan Jobs 2026 – Details

CategoryDetails
Post NameWildlife Watcher (BPS-07)
Total Vacancies12 (08 General Merit, 04 Minority Quota)
EducationIntermediate (F.A/F.Sc) from a recognized board
Age Limit18 to 30 Years
DomicileDI Khan District and Tank District
Application PortalETEA (www.etea.edu.pk)
Last Date to ApplyMay 20, 2026

Job Positions and Quotas

Out of the total vacancies:

  • 8 positions are allocated under the general quota
  • 4 positions are reserved for minority candidates

This quota system reflects the government’s commitment to inclusive hiring practices. The positions are specifically open to candidates from Dera Ismail Khan and Tank districts, making domicile a critical eligibility requirement.

Job Responsibilities in the Wildlife Department

Field Duties and Conservation Work

Working as a Wildlife Watcher is like being a guardian of nature. Your daily tasks might include patrolling forests, monitoring wildlife activity, and preventing illegal hunting. These roles require constant vigilance and a strong sense of responsibility.

You may find yourself trekking through rugged terrains, observing animal behavior, or even assisting in rescue operations. It’s not glamorous, but it’s incredibly rewarding. Every action you take contributes to preserving biodiversity for future generations.

Monitoring and Protection Roles

Wildlife Watchers are also responsible for:

  • Reporting illegal activities such as poaching
  • Assisting senior officers in conservation projects
  • Maintaining records of wildlife sightings

Think of it as being both a protector and a researcher. You’re not just guarding animals—you’re helping scientists and policymakers understand ecosystems better.


Salary, Benefits, and Career Growth

One of the biggest attractions of these jobs is the government pay scale (BPS-07). While the starting salary may range between PKR 40,000 to 50,000, it comes with several perks.

Benefits include:

  • Job security
  • Pension plans
  • Medical facilities
  • Annual increments

Over time, employees can be promoted to higher positions like Deputy Ranger or Range Officer, opening doors to leadership roles.
